Ron Paul Introduces the American Freedom Agenda Act

Statement Introducing the American Freedom Agenda Act of 2007
Ron Paul Speech to Congress
October 15, 2007

American Freedom Agenda Act Complete Text - 3 pages.

Madam Speaker, today I am introducing a comprehensive piece of legislation to restore the American Constitution and to restore the liberties that have been sadly eroded over the past several years.

This legislation seeks to restore the checks and balances enshrined in the Constitution by our Founding Fathers to prevent abuse of Americans by their government. This proposed legislation would repeal the Military Commissions Act of 2006 and re-establish the traditional practice that military commissions may be used to try war crimes in places of active hostility where a rapid trial is necessary to preserve evidence or prevent chaos.
